Software Architect

3 weeks ago


Newark, Delaware, United States Hire Talent Full time

Job Description:

We are seeking a highly skilled Software Engineer to join our team at Hire Talent. The ideal candidate will have a strong background in software development and a passion for designing, creating, testing, and deploying solutions across multiple technology domains.

Key Responsibilities:

  • Collaborate with technology, architecture, product management, and design teams to drive outcomes with a focus on enriched customer experience.
  • Foster an iterative/Agile environment.
  • Work across teams to produce elegant solutions to challenging engineering and business problems.
  • Write original code to deliver end-to-end solutions using innovative approaches to complex design problems.
  • Build features, enhancements, bug fixes, and conduct troubleshooting and remediation of production problems when needed.
  • Support features in all environments and provide/maintain supporting documentation.
  • Remediates defects found in code through the lifecycle of the code.
  • Reverse engineers code as needed.

Requirements:

  • Must possess an undergraduate degree with a concentration in Computer Science, Information Technology, Electrical Engineering, or a related field, or equivalent practical experience.
  • 3+ years of experience in the development and design of complex applications.
  • Understanding of Agile SDLC methodologies is required.

Technical Qualifications:

  • Deep proficiency in more than one programming language is required. Knowledge of Spring Boot framework, Microservices, AWS, Java, SQL, will be required.
  • Strong understanding and experience of asynchronous processing technologies like Active Mq, Kafka, AWS SQS.
  • Must have experience with service implementation using rest-based standards, experience with developing true microservices highly desirable.
  • Must have previous experience building and delivering APIs and platforms for consumption at scale.
  • Must understand and have worked with security concepts like authentication, authorization, encryption, digital signature, MFA, SSL, etc.
  • Must have experience with web service proxies, firewalls, multi-protocol gateways, etc.
  • Must know how to build applications for and in the cloud (preferably AWS) and understand the core AWS services and apply best practices regarding security and scalability.
  • Understanding of core AWS services, uses, and basic AWS architecture best practices.
  • Proficiency writing code for serverless applications such as EC2, Lambda, and API Gateway.
  • Understanding of cloud databases and NoSQL concepts (DynamoDB, Aurora) including caching (ElastiCache).
  • Build highly performing and scalable microservices following enterprise guidelines and standards.
  • Ability to use a CI/CD pipeline to deploy applications on Cloud (preferably AWS) using GIT lab, Jenkins, and cloud formation templates.
  • Experience with AWS EKS, SQS, SES, S3, and Redis is a plus.
  • Experience with GIT source control and GitHub Enterprise.
  • Experience in using Jira, Confluence, and Service Now.
  • Experience with developing large-scale, high-traffic, auto-scalable applications in the cloud highly desired.

Equal Employment Opportunity:

Hire Talent is an equal opportunity employer and welcomes applications from diverse candidates.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ender, identity, national origin, disability, or protected veteran status.


  • Software Architect

    4 weeks ago


    Newark, Delaware, United States Seven Seven Software Full time

    Job Title: Software ArchitectAs a Software Architect at Seven Seven Software, you will be responsible for designing and developing complex software systems that meet the needs of our clients. Your expertise in software architecture, cloud computing, and DevOps will be essential in driving the success of our projects.Key Responsibilities:Design and develop...

  • Software Architect

    3 weeks ago


    Newark, Delaware, United States Seven Seven Software Full time

    Job SummaryAt Seven Seven Software, we are seeking a highly skilled Software Engineer to join our team. As a key member of our engineering team, you will be responsible for designing, developing, and deploying complex software applications. ResponsibilitiesCollaborate with cross-functional teams to drive outcomes and deliver high-quality software...

  • Data Engineer

    3 weeks ago


    Newark, Delaware, United States Seven Seven Software Full time

    Job Title: Data Engineer - Cloud ArchitectJob Summary:Seven Seven Software is seeking a highly skilled Data Engineer - Cloud Architect to design, build, and maintain efficient, reusable, and reliable architecture and code. The ideal candidate will have experience implementing, supporting data lakes, data warehouses, and data applications on AWS for large...

  • Data Engineer

    4 weeks ago


    Newark, Delaware, United States Seven Seven Software Full time

    Job SummarySeven Seven Software is seeking a highly skilled Data Engineer - Cloud Architect to join our team. As a key member of our engineering team, you will be responsible for designing, building, and maintaining efficient, reusable, and reliable architecture and code for our data engineering projects. Key ResponsibilitiesDesign and implement data...


  • Newark, Delaware, United States Seven Seven Software Full time

    Job DescriptionAs a Data Integration Architect at Seven Seven Software, you will be responsible for leading the design, development, and implementation of data integration solutions using Informatica, DB2, and Snowflake. You will work closely with stakeholders to gather and analyze data integration requirements, collaborate with cross-functional teams to...


  • Newark, Delaware, United States Seven Seven Software Full time

    Job Description:We are seeking a highly skilled Cloud Solutions Architect to join our team at Seven Seven Software. As a key member of our Engineering and DevOps practice, you will be responsible for designing and implementing large-scale cloud solutions using cutting-edge web technologies and AWS Engineering. Your expertise in DevOps tools, Drupal, and...


  • Newark, Delaware, United States Hologic Full time

    The Principal Systems Architect at Hologic is responsible for defining and developing technical platforms and system specifications for top-tier products.This role involves identifying and resolving system design weaknesses, contributing to the architectural framework across products, and collaborating with cross-functional teams to develop reliable medical...


  • Newark, Delaware, United States Seven Seven Software Full time

    Job Title: AEM Technical SpecialistJob Summary: We are seeking an experienced AEM Technical Specialist to join our team at Seven Seven Software.Key Responsibilities:* Develop and implement AEM-based solutions to meet business requirements* Collaborate with product owners, tech leads, designers, and engineers to design and architect AEM solutions* Create and...


  • Newark, Delaware, United States CAI Full time

    Job SummaryWe are seeking a highly skilled Salesforce Technical Architect to lead the architectural design and framework for our large-scale projects. The successful candidate will have a strong background in Salesforce ecosystems with a deep understanding of the platform's capabilities and limitations.Key ResponsibilitiesDesign and implement critical...


  • Newark, Delaware, United States Moody's Full time

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our team at Moody's. As a key member of our engineering team, you will be responsible for designing, developing, and deploying state-of-the-art commercial and consumer application solutions to understand and manage risks.The ideal candidate will have a strong background in...


  • Newark, Delaware, United States Search Solutions Full time

    Job SummarySearch Solutions is seeking a seasoned Senior Software Engineering Manager to lead our Product Engineering team. As a key member of our engineering leadership, you will be responsible for architecting, coding, and collaborating to produce full stack solutions using modern frameworks and technologies.This is a remote opportunity, although the...


  • Newark, Delaware, United States Hire Talent Full time

    Job SummaryAs a Technical Lead on Distribution Retirement Strategies, you will partner with product owners, designers, engineers, and delivery professionals to improve PruXpress and other Distribution Software. You will provide guidance on technical strategy, design the overall technology architecture, and mentor and coach the technical team as you implement...


  • Newark, Delaware, United States Seven Seven Software Full time

    Job RequirementsWe are seeking a highly skilled Cloud Infrastructure Specialist to join our team at Seven Seven Software. The ideal candidate will have 2-5 years of experience in Python programming and API development, with a preference for experience in FAST API.Key responsibilities include:Managing Containers, Docker, Kubernetes, EKS, and HelmUtilizing AWS...


  • Newark, Delaware, United States Hologic Full time

    Job SummaryThe Senior Systems Architect will be responsible for defining and developing technical platforms and system specifications for Hologic's top-tier products. This role involves identifying and resolving system design weaknesses, contributing to the architectural framework across products, and collaborating with cross-functional teams to develop...


  • Newark, Delaware, United States Amazon Full time

    About This RoleAs a UX Architect, Design Systems at Audible, you will play a key role in shaping the future of audio storytelling. You will be responsible for crafting refined reusable interface elements and improving usability for harmonious listening anytime, anywhere, on any platform – iOS, Android, Web, and Alexa.With a deep understanding of our...


  • Newark, Delaware, United States Seven Seven Software Full time

    Job Title: Informatica Developer LeadJob Summary:Seven Seven Software is seeking an experienced Informatica Developer Lead to join our team. The successful candidate will be responsible for providing technical leadership in the design, development, and implementation of data integration solutions using Informatica, DB2, and Snowflake.Key Responsibilities:...


  • Newark, Delaware, United States Moody's Full time

    About the RoleMoodys is a global integrated risk assessment firm that empowers organizations to make better decisions. We are seeking a Senior Software Engineer to join our team to create state-of-the-art commercial and consumer application solutions to understand and manage risks, from earthquakes, hurricanes, and floods to terrorism and infectious...


  • Newark, Delaware, United States Amazon Full time

    At Audible, we're passionate about creating immersive audio experiences that inspire and enrich our customers' lives. As a Lead Software Development Engineer on our Playback team, you'll play a key role in shaping the technical direction of our platform and driving innovation in audio storytelling.We're looking for a seasoned engineer with a strong...


  • Newark, Delaware, United States Diverse Lynx Full time

    Contact Center ExpertiseAs a seasoned Cloud Contact Center Platform Engineer, you will design, configure, develop, and support Conversational IVR's and Chatbots leveraging Genesys Cloud Architect tool and Amazon Lex & Lambda. Your expertise in API/Web Service integrations to back-end systems (REST, Json, and SQL database) will be invaluable in delivering...


  • Newark, Delaware, United States Seven Seven Software Full time

    Job SummaryThe Data Marketplace Platform Administrator is responsible for the administration, configuration, and maintenance of the Informatica Cloud Data Marketplace platform. This role ensures the availability, performance, and security of the data marketplace, enabling seamless data sharing and collaboration within the organization.Key...